What makes a roof 'storm-resistant' for Loch Lomond's severe weather?
Loch Lomond's 115 mph Ultimate Design Wind Speed Zone requires shingles with ASTM D7158 Class H ratings and six-nail patterns per shingle. Class 4 impact-rated shingles withstand 2-inch hail strikes common during August-September tropical remnants, preventing granule loss that exposes asphalt to UV degradation. These specifications, combined with FORTIFIED-standard ice and water shield at eaves and valleys, transform the roof from a liability to an asset that survives peak storm seasons with minimal claims.
What are the current code requirements for roof replacements in Prince William County?
The 2021 IRC with Virginia USBC amendments mandates ice and water shield extending 24 inches inside the exterior wall line, not just at eaves. Contractors licensed by Virginia DPOR must secure Prince William County Building Development Division permits, ensuring flashing integrates with wall assemblies and drip edges direct water away from fascia. These 2026 standards address wind-driven rain penetration during 115 mph events, with inspections verifying compliance before final approval protects both homeowner investment and neighborhood resilience.

I have attic mold despite my roof appearing intact. Could ventilation be the issue?
Loch Lomond's 4/12 pitch roofs require balanced intake at soffits and exhaust at ridges per 2021 IRC Virginia amendments. Inadequate airflow traps humid air against the plywood decking, promoting mold growth that compromises indoor air quality and decking integrity. Proper ventilation maintains attic temperatures within 10°F of outdoor ambient, reducing ice dam risks in winter and shingle thermal stress in summer. A professional assessment measures net free area against the home's square footage for code compliance.

Should I install traditional shingles or solar shingles when replacing my roof?
Architectural asphalt shingles offer proven 30-year performance at lower initial cost, while integrated solar shingles leverage Loch Lomond's net metering and 30% federal ITC. Solar shingles require specific roof orientations and pitches to maximize energy production, potentially complicating the 4/12 slope common here. Evaluate 2026 energy costs against the premium for solar integration; traditional shingles with conduit pathways allow future panel additions without compromising the waterproofing assembly during this replacement cycle.
